When a salesperson sells 3 appliances in a month, she is paid $2450.
When a salesperson sells 7 appliances in a month, she is paid $3050.
Let x represent the number of appliances sold in a particular month.
Let y represent the pay for that month.
A. Find the equation of the line that represents this situation.
B. How much would they earn if they sold 11 appliances?
C. How many appliances were sold during the month if she earned $4100?
